OSPF协议详解:内部路由、区域与外部路由

版权申诉
0 下载量 53 浏览量 更新于2024-08-29 收藏 42KB DOC 举报
"本文档详细介绍了OSPF(Open Shortest Path First,开放式最短路径优先)协议,包括其工作原理、成本计算方式、区域划分以及不同类型的路由,并提到了OSPF的配置和认证机制。" OSPF是一种广泛使用的内部网关协议(IGP),用于在一个自治系统(AS)内传播路由信息。它基于链路状态算法,能够快速收敛并提供无环路的最短路径树。OSPF的核心概念是通过交换LSA(Link State Advertisements)来构建全网的拓扑视图。 OSPF的成本计算通常是基于链路带宽的,公式为:带宽/100M。但也可以通过命令`ip ospf cost <value>`进行手动设定。成本越低,路径被选择的可能性越大。 在OSPF中,区域(Area)的概念非常重要,其中区域0被视为骨干区(Backbone Area),连接其他非骨干区域,确保网络通信。区域内路由(Intra-Area Routes)是指目标在同一区域内的路由,这些路由在路由表中以“O”标识。 跨区域路由(Inter-Area or Summary Routes)源自其他区域,它们在路由表中显示为“OIA”。这些路由用于连接不同区域,提供对其他区域网络的访问。 外部路由(External Routes)来自其他路由协议或不同的OSPF进程,并通过重分布注入OSPF。根据类型,外部路由分为E1和E2,其中E1(External Type 1)考虑了OSPF内部和外部的全部成本,而E2(External Type 2)仅计算ASBR( Autonomous System Boundary Router)到外部网络的成本。默认情况下,OSPF使用E2类型。 配置OSPF路由器的基本步骤包括启用OSPF服务并定义网络接口参与的区域。例如: ``` router OSPF 100 network 192.213.0.0 0.0.255.255 area 0.0.0.0 network 128.213.1.1 0.0.0.0 area 232 ``` OSPF还支持多种认证方式,包括无认证、简单密码认证和消息摘要认证(MD5)。简单认证使用一个共享的明文密码来保护OSPF通信,但安全性较低。相比之下,MD5认证提供了更强的安全性,通过加密算法验证数据完整性。 总结,OSPF是一个强大的IGP,其复杂性和灵活性使其成为大型网络中的首选协议。理解其核心概念、路由类型和配置方法对于网络管理员来说至关重要。